礦池算力和全網算力
難度是對挖礦困難程度的度量,即指:計算符合給定目標的一個HASH值的困難程度。
difficulty = difficulty_1_target / current_target
difficulty_1_target 的長度為256bit, 前32位為0, 後面全部為1 ,一般顯示為HASH值:, difficulty_1_target 表示btc網路最初的目標HASH。 current_target 是當前塊的目標HASH,先經過壓縮然後存儲在區塊中,區塊的HASH值必須小於給定的目標HASH, 區塊才成立。
例如:如果區塊中存儲的壓縮目標HASH為 0x1b0404cb , 那麼未經壓縮的十六進制HASH為
所以,目標HASH為0x1b0404cb時, 難度為:
比特幣的挖礦的過程其實是通過隨機的hash碰撞,找到一個解 nonce ,使得 塊hash 小於 目標HASH 值。 而一個礦機每秒鍾能做多少次hash碰撞, 就是其「算力」的代表, 單位寫成 hash/s 或者 H/s
算力單位:
比特幣系統的難度是動態調整的, 每挖 2016 個塊便會做出一次調整, 調整的依據是前面2016個塊的出塊時間, 如果前一個周期平均出塊時間小於10分鍾,便會加大難度, 大於10分鍾,則減小難度,目的是為了保證系統穩定的每過 10分鍾 產出一個塊,所以難度調整的時間大概是2周(2016 * 10 分鍾)
全網算力是btc網路中參與競爭挖礦的所有礦機的算力總和。當前難度周期全網算力會影響下一個周期的難度調整, 如果全網算力增加,挖礦難度增大,單台礦機固定時間的產出就會減少。目前全網算力大概是24.42EH/s, 一台螞蟻S9礦機的算力大概是14TH/s
那麼, 已知當前全網算力,下一個周期難度將如何調整呢?
根據公式:
因為出塊時間要穩定在10分鍾, 也就是600s:
那麼,在3.46e+12的難度下, 一台算力為14TH/s的礦機平均要花多長時間才能出一個塊呢?
根據公式:
有:
結果大概是12270天
② 礦池算力和本地算力的區別什麼是礦池算力和本地算力
礦池算力和本地算力有什麼區別,很多人在挖礦的時候發現下卡的本地算力很穩定,礦池上的算力卻經常出現波動,很多人就不明白礦池算力和本地的顯卡算力有什麼關系,這兩個有什麼區別,下面跟著小編一起來看看吧,希望此文章能幫到你。
什麼是本地算力
本地算力就是礦機或者顯卡本身的計算能力,這是一個性能指標,這個其實只是一個參考值,就像我們買東西的時候圖片上寫的就是僅供參考,和這個意思類似。
什歷歷么是礦池算力
礦池算力是顯示在你所挖礦池的查詢頁面上,這里的算力數據是一個評價實際運算工作量的數據指標,礦池的算力才是和我們收益關系最大的,礦池匯總只要我們提供有效share的數量,就可以獲得獎勵了。
本地算力和礦池算力的關系
一般情況礦池算力會顯示信爛消成兩個數據,短時間算力和瞬時算力,還有一個就是長時間算力和24小時算力,短時間算力,比如半個小時就是統計半個小時的有效share然後按照權重進行反推出來的平均算力值,長期算力就是24小時提交的滑知有效share然後按照權重反推出來的平均算力值。
③ 什麼是礦池
礦池指的是:
由於比特幣全網的運算水準在不斷的呈指數級別上漲,單個設備或少量的算力都無法在比特幣網路上獲取到比特幣網路提供的區塊獎勵。
在全網算力提升到了一定程度後,過低的獲取獎勵的概率,促使一些「bitcointalk」上的極客開發出一種可以將少量算力合並聯合運作的方法,使用這種方式建立的網站便被稱作「礦池」。
(3)礦池算力和全網算力擴展閱讀:
礦池的存在降低了比特幣等虛擬數字貨幣開採的難度,降低了開采門檻,真正實現了人人皆可參與的比特幣挖礦理念。
但其弊端也非常明顯,因為算力接入礦池,作為礦池來說,將掌握極其龐大的算力資源,在比特幣世界中,算力代表著記賬權,算力即是一切,如果單家礦池算力達到50%以上,將可以輕易對比特幣等類似的虛擬數字貨幣發動51%攻擊,其後果是非常可怕的:
礦池可使掌握剩餘49%算力的礦池顆粒無收,瞬間退出競爭並倒閉破產,礦池算力超過50%以上,如果發動51%攻擊,將能輕易占據全網全部有效算力。
④ 算力是什麼
算力指計算能力,指的是在通過「挖礦」得到比特幣的過程中,我們需要找到其相應的解m,而對於任何一個六十四位的哈希值,要找到其解m,都沒有固定演算法,只能靠計算機隨機的hash碰撞,而一個挖礦機每秒鍾能做多少次hash碰撞,就是其「算力」的代表,單位寫成hash/s,這就是所謂工作量證明機制pow(proof
of
work)。
1p的全網算力意味著什麼?、
首先,1p算力,折算下來,相當於105萬g左右,這意味著,如果你擁有1g的全網算力,你差不多可以獲得全網產出的比特幣的105萬分之一。按比特幣每天產出3800個計算,我們可以看到1g的算力每天的收益已經下降到了0.0036個比特幣,按當前市價計算約為2.7元左右,如果算上電力成本和礦機硬體成本,盈利幾乎已經沒有了。
其次,1p的全網算力看似驚人,但實際上,一年以後,你會覺得這個只是小兒科,因為cointerra公司將在12月推出2p的礦機,而bitmine公司將在明年3月推出4p的礦機,如果這些公司不被敘利亞投放生化武器的話,一年以後比特幣全網算力達到10p以上應該在意料之中,屆時,1g算力每天將只能挖到0.00036個比特幣。
⑤ 什麼是全網算力 怎麼查詢全網算力
在一些加密貨幣發展狀況與礦機的新聞中,我們經常能看到“全網算力”這個詞語,它似乎是一個重要的參數指標,但具體指的是什麼,怎麼查詢全網算力,下面我就來做個科普。
全網算力可以按字面理解,既網路中所有參與挖礦的礦機算力總和。舉個簡單的例子,網路中共有1億台礦機,每台礦機的算力是10T,那麼全網算力就是10億T,換算一下單位就是100E算力。這里需要注意一下單位,完整的寫法後面還應該加hash/s,前面舉例的數值應該是100Ehash/s,表示每秒可完成100E次hash(哈希值)計算。另外也說一下字母M、G、T、P、E的含義,其中1M就是常說的100萬,相鄰字母之間是1000倍的關系,也就是1E=1000P=1000000T=1000000000G=1000000000000M。
某種加密貨幣的全網算力大小,可以反映出該加密貨幣挖礦的活躍度,數值越大、增長速度越快,說明礦工都看好這種加密唯皮余貨幣,它的前景一般也會很好。此外,我們也可以根據全網算力去判斷一些消握攜息的真偽,比如今年年初比特幣價格大跌,有一種說法稱挖礦賠錢,礦工都不去挖礦,礦機也賣不出去了,但通查詢可知那段時間全網算力的數值一直是快速增長的,很顯然有更多的礦工與礦機投入,而非沒人去挖礦,數據是不會說謊的。
如何查詢某種加密貨幣的全網算力數值?一般該加密貨幣的礦池、瀏覽器中都提供全網算力數值,比如要查詢比特幣的全網算力,可以去比特幣瀏覽器blockchain.info網站查看,注意全網算力的英文名字叫“HASH RATE”。另外,也有一些加密貨幣統計的網站,比如bitinfocharts.com也提供全網算力的指滾數值查詢。
⑥ 算力是什麼意思
算力是比特幣網路處理能力的度量單位。即為計算機計算哈希函數輸出的速度。比特幣網路必須為了安全目的而進行密集的數學和加密相關操作。 例如,當網路達到10Th/s的哈希率時,意味著它可以每秒進行10萬億次計算。
在通過「挖礦」得到比特幣的過程中,我們需要找到其相應的解m,而對於任何一個六十四位的哈希值,要找到其解m,都沒有固定演算法,只能靠計算機隨機的hash碰撞,而一個挖礦機每秒鍾能做多少次hash碰撞,就是其「算力」的代表,單位寫成hash/s,這就是所謂工作量證明機制POW。
(6)礦池算力和全網算力擴展閱讀
算力為大數據的發展提供堅實的基礎保障,大數據的爆發式增長,給現有算力提出了巨大挑戰。互聯網時代的大數據高速積累,全球數據總量幾何式增長,現有的計算能力已經不能滿足需求。據IDC報告,全球信息數據90% 產生於最近幾年。並且到2020年,40% 左右的信息會被雲計算服務商收存,其中1/3 的數據具有價值。
因此算力的發展迫在眉睫,否則將會極大束縛人工智慧的發展應用。我國在算力、演算法方面與世界先進水平有較大差距。算力的核心在晶元。因此需要在算力領域加大研發投入,縮小甚至趕超與世界發達國家差距。
算力單位
1 kH / s =每秒1,000哈希
1 MH / s =每秒1,000,000次哈希。
1 GH / s =每秒1,000,000,000次哈希。
1 TH / s =每秒1,000,000,000,000次哈希。
1 PH / s =每秒1,000,000,000,000,000次哈希。
1 EH / s =每秒1,000,000,000,000,000,000次哈希。
⑦ 一文了解以太坊挖礦演算法及算力規模2020-09-09
以太坊網路中,想要獲得以太坊,也要通過挖礦來實現。當前以太坊也是採用POW共識機制,但是與比特幣的POW挖礦有點不一樣,以太坊挖礦難度是可以調節的。以太坊系統有一個特殊的公式用來計算之後的每個塊的難度。如果某個區塊比前一個區塊驗證的更快,以太坊協議就會增加區塊的難度。通過調整區塊難度,就可以調整驗證區塊所需的時間。
以太坊採用的是Ethash 加密演算法,在挖礦的過程中,需要讀取內存並存儲 DAG 文件。由於每一次讀取內寸的帶寬都是有限的,而現有的計算機技術又很難在這個問題上有質的突破,所以無論如何提高計算機的運算效率,內存讀取效率仍然不會有很大的改觀。因此,從某種意義上來說,以太坊的Ethash加密演算法具有「抗ASIC性」。
加密演算法的不同,導致了比特幣和以太坊的挖礦設備、算力規模差異很大。
目前,比特幣挖礦設備主要是專業化程度非常高的ASIC 礦機,單台礦機的算力最高達到了 112T/s(神馬M30S++礦機),全網算力的規模達到139.92EH/s。
以太坊的挖礦設備主要是顯卡礦機和定製GPU礦機,專業化的ASIC礦機非常少,一方面是因為以太坊挖礦演算法的「抗 ASIC 性」提高了研發ASIC礦機的門檻,另一方面是因為以太坊升級到2.0之後共識機制會轉型為PoS,礦機無法繼續挖。
和ASIC礦機相比,顯卡礦機在算力上相差了2個量級。目前,主流的顯卡礦機(8卡)算力約為420MH/s,比較領先的定製GPU礦機算力約在500M~750M,以太坊全網算力約為235.39TH/s。
從過去兩年的時間維度上看,以太坊的全網算力增長相對緩慢。
以太坊協議規定,難度的動態調整方式是使全網創建新區塊的時間間隔為15秒,網路用15秒時間創建區塊鏈,這樣一來,因為時間太快,系統的同步性就大大提升,惡意參與者很難在如此短的時間發動51%(也就是半數以上)的算力去修改歷史數據。